Maintainability of appeal before ITAT - Commissioner (Appeals) need to be approached first - The order sought to be impugned in this appeal is passed by the AO and, therefore, this exception does not come into play. Learned counsel’s understanding of the legal position, even if bonafide- particularly considering his young age and limited experience, is clearly incorrect. The appeal filed before us is thus indeed not maintainable in law. - AT
